Beijing, March 15 – China is increasingly restricting minority autonomy in education, language, and religion through both political campaigns and legal reforms. By codifying assimilation policies into law, Beijing is entering a new stage of frontier governance – one aimed not just at managing...

Beijing, March 13 The World Uyghur Congress (WUC) has expressed serious concern over China's newly approved law on "Promoting Ethnic Unity and Progress," adopted during the annual parliamentary session of the Chinese Communist Party, warning that it could intensify repression against Uyghurs...

Beijing, March 12 China's Parliament concluded its highly publicized annual session on Thursday, approving a range of laws, including the new five-year plan to address the country's economic slowdown, an increased defense budget, and the controversial ethnic law mandating Mandarin for all ethnic...
